All checks were successful
CI / lint-and-test (push) Successful in 22s
- Added Docker health check endpoint to the FastAPI application, returning a 200 status when the app is running. - Updated Dockerfile to include curl for health checks and modified entrypoint script to exit on errors. - Enhanced .dockerignore and .gitignore files to exclude coverage and test artifacts. - Updated docker-compose.prod.yml to specify version. - Added pytest-cov as a development dependency to improve test coverage reporting.
16 lines
145 B
Plaintext
16 lines
145 B
Plaintext
.env
|
|
__pycache__/
|
|
venv/
|
|
.venv/
|
|
*.pyc
|
|
*.pyo
|
|
data/
|
|
*.db
|
|
.cursor/
|
|
# Test and coverage artifacts
|
|
.coverage
|
|
htmlcov/
|
|
.pytest_cache/
|
|
*.cover
|
|
*.plan.md
|